It is in Irish, English and French and located here C6138 : The pier, Moville The English text includes the following wording, "The Fid Carved from a single oak. Over the 19th and 20th centuries this pier was a point of departure for emigrant ships bound for Canada and America. Of the hundreds and thousands of Irish who left their homeland to make the arduous journey, many settled in the Province of New Brunswick, Canada where they left an indelible mark on that province and nation." The artist was Locky Morris
